Possible new PlayStation Portal model pays homage to the Vita's OLED

While much of the focus on PlayStation's next steps is the PS6 and PS6 Portable , the two-year old PlayStation Portal could be getting a revamp according to those pesky internet rumours.  Update : Hints at pricing are around £/$250-299 for the new model, but everything remains deeply in rumours territory. Presumably the goal is to hit the 10% (currently 7%-ish) adoption rate among PS5 owners, something that would make it a bone fide hit gadget.   The recent February  PlayStation State of Play  saw no announcement. But, PlayStation needs to make Portal more a core member of the PS5 family, rather than the distant cousin that most of its appearances suggest.  As the improvement in connectivity and streaming tech, proven by many gamers enjoying their PS5 or PlayStation Plus streamed content from around the world, an updated Portal Pro could be on the cards.  Possibly featuring a 120Hz display and an OLED screen in honour of the mighty Vita, that'd be coo...

Ikaruga switches colour on Switch

Legendary Treasure-developed shooter and Dreamcast icon heads to the Switch thanks to Nicalis. Ikaruga is one of the Japanese developers great shooters, using a colour switching mechanic to avoid the bullet hell infested levels as you swoop in and out of huge pseudo-3D space and city battles.


Loved it on the Dreamcast, not so much in this weird format they use for widescreen TVs, but put the Switch up vertically and it looks the real deal, with two player mode (I think). Whichever way you play, still an awesome game. Releasing digital at the end of May.
